Which crop can deplete maximum micro-nutrients from soil?

A.
Rice
B.
Maize
Answer
C.
Wheat
D.
Cowpea

Answer: Option B

Solution

Answer: Option B
Solution:
Maize is a crop that can deplete maximum micro-nutrients from the soil.
Soil nutrient depletion can be attributed to insufficient fertilizer use, unbalanced fertilization, and nutrient depletion-induced soil fertility problems.
Growing corn uses a lot of water and fertilizer, especially nitrogen and phosphorus and some of these production techniques, are coupled with the effects of climate change.
